Itinerary Breakdown and Highlights
Starting Point — The Pink Church
The tour begins in front of the Pink Church, which is a colorful and recognizable landmark. From here, your guide, often named Thao or Linh, will lead you into the bustling streets where vendors sell everything from grilled skewers to fresh seafood.
Market Visits — Bac My An Market
One of the tour’s key stops is Bac My An Market, which is a lively hub for locals. Here, you’ll witness the vibrant chaos of vendors calling out, and you’ll get to sample some of the best street snacks Da Nang has to offer. According to reviews, visitors loved “the chance to see authentic market life up close,” and many appreciated the opportunity to ask questions about ingredients and dishes.
Hidden Gems and Iconic Spots
Beyond the markets, your guide might take you to lesser-known stalls or special shops that aren’t listed in typical tourist guides, adding an element of discovery. Visiting Ba Da Pagoda offers a glimpse into spiritual life and provides a peaceful break amidst the busy food sights, adding cultural depth to your culinary journey.
Tastings — 10 Local Food & Drink Samples
The highlight? Tasting a carefully curated selection of local street foods, which might include:
- Banh Xeo — a crispy, savory pancake filled with shrimp and bean sprouts, loved for its crunch and flavor.
- Banh Mi — a Vietnamese sandwich with fresh herbs, meats, and pickles.
- Grilled seafood — fresh and smoky, perfect for seaside Vietnam.
- Avocado Ice Cream — unique to Da Nang, this creamy treat surprises many with its subtle sweetness and smooth texture.
Guests frequently mention how much they appreciated the variety — “the mix of sweet and savory bites kept things interesting,” as one reviewer shared.
Cultural and Historical Insights
Throughout the tour, your guide will share stories about each dish’s origins and significance. For example, you might learn how Banh Xeo has been a local favorite for generations or how markets like Bac My An serve as social hubs as much as food sources. This context elevates the tasting experience from mere snacking to a meaningful cultural exploration.

FAQ
Is this tour suitable for vegetarians?
Yes, vegetarian options are available, and the tour can be tailored to dietary preferences.
How long does the tour last?
The experience lasts about 3 hours, giving ample time to enjoy all tastings and sightseeing.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es, a camera, cash, a charged smartphone, and a reusable water bottle are recommended.
Where does the tour start and end?
It begins in front of the Pink Church and ends back at the same meeting point.
Are children allowed?
The tour is not suitable for babies under 1 year or people over 95 years, but older children who enjoy walking and tasting are welcome.
Is the tour private?
Yes, it’s a fully private experience, perfect for couples, families, or small groups.
Can I book and pay later?
Yes, you can reserve your spot now and pay nothing until closer to your tour date.
Are there any hidden costs?
All tastings and guide services are included; extra purchases or drinks are at your discretion.
What if I have special dietary needs?
The tour is customizable, and the guide can accommodate vegetarian or other dietary restrictions.
